× Yes, I use my headphones to listen to the music and call with my friends who lives in America.
✓ Yes, I use my headphones to listen to music and call my friends who live in America.
Subject-pronoun agreement and relative clause: 'friends' is plural so the relative clause must use 'who live' not 'who lives'. Also 'listen to the music' is acceptable but more natural as 'listen to music' without the definite article in this context. × I use headphones from Bose and it's white and I voted three years ago.
✓ I use headphones from Bose and they're white, and I bought them three years ago.
Third-person agreement and word choice: 'headphones' is plural so use 'they're' not 'it's'. 'Voted' is incorrect verb here; likely intended 'bought'. Also add 'them' to refer back to headphones. × I use my headphones when I call my friend who lives in US and I also use them when I listen to the music on the bus.
✓ I use my headphones when I call my friend who lives in the US, and I also use them when I listen to music on the bus.
Definite article and article use with country names and general activities: 'US' usually takes the definite article 'the US'. 'Listen to the music' is better as 'listen to music' for general activity. Suggestions: add 'the' before 'US' and remove 'the' before 'music' for general statements. × I don't use headphones when my ears have illness because of because my because I used headphones to for a long time then I don't use my headphones and just chill.
✓ I don't use headphones when my ears are painful or infected because if I use them for a long time my ears get worse, so I don't use them and just rest.
Multiple structural and word-form issues: 'have illness' is incorrect; use 'are painful' or 'are infected' or 'have an infection'. Remove repeated 'because of because my because'. 'Used headphones to for a long time' is wrong order; use 'use them for a long time'. Also use consistent tense and clearer connectors: 'if' or 'when' and 'so'.
